Q: What are Trader Joe’s pine nuts?

A: Trader Joe’s pine nuts are a type of edible seed harvested from the cones of specific species of pine trees. They have a delicate, sweet flavor, and are used in various culinary applications such as salads, pesto sauces, and baked goods.

Q: What nutritional content do they contain?

A: Trader Joe’s pine nuts are a good source of protein and healthy fats. They also contain minerals such as iron, zinc, potassium, phosphorus and magnesium. Additionally, they provide vitamins B1 (Thiamin), B2 (Riboflavin), folate, Vitamin E and dietary fiber.

Q: How can I store them for longevity?

A: To ensure that your supply of Trader Joe’s pine nuts remains fresh for longer periods of time it is important to store them in a cool dark place away from heat sources or direct sunlight. Vacuum sealing them into airtight containers helps maintain their crunchy texture too!

Q: How can I use this nut in cooking?

A: Pine nuts can be used in both savory dishes or sweets depending on the desired flavor profile. The most common way to use them is to add them directly to recipes such as pesto sauce where they can bring out the richness of flavors like olive oil or Parmesan cheese. Alternatively they can be incorporated into batters when baking items like muffins or cookies to create an interesting texture contrast between softness and crunchiness.

1) Pine Nut Parmesan Crisps – These crunchy bites will disappear before you know it! Simply combine one cup of grated parmesan cheese with half cup of Trader Joe’s pine nuts in a food processor. Pulse until everything is fully incorporated and then roll spoonfuls of the mixture into round shapes on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Bake for 8 minutes at 350 degrees and enjoy these delectable morsels over salad or soup!

2) Classic Pesto – Customize this classic recipe by adding in an extra special touch—pine nuts! Blend together 2 cups packed fresh basil leaves, 3 cloves garlic, ¼ cup extra-virgin olive oil, ¾ cup freshly grated Parmesan cheese, salt & pepper (to taste), and ½ cup Trader Joe’s crushed Pine Nuts in a food processor until smooth; if needed add up to 3 tablespoons of water while blending. Store pesto in an airtight container in the refrigerator until ready to use
